Product Information
Extended Description
DH226FPK Eaton: Eaton Heavy duty single-throw fused safety switch, Enhanced visible blade, 600 A, NEMA 4, Painted steel, Class H, Two-pole, Two-wire, 240 V, Max Hp: 75, 200 hp (3PH @ Std fuse/time delay), (1)#2-(1)600 kcmil and (1)#1/0-(1)750 kcmil Cu/Al

Catalog Notes
Suitable for service entrance use with a neutral or ground lug kit installed. Hp ratings apply only when neutral is field installed and switch is used on a grounded B phase system.
